Re: VPN Client and the Internet



There isn't anything that you can do at the server end. Any changes would have to be made on the client. If they are using Windows and the builtin VPN client you can modify the settings. By default the VPN connection becomes the default gateway, so everything goes across the VPN link.

When VPN clients connect into our network they lose Internet access on their local (workgroup) network.

Is there anyway to configure them or our Win2003 server so they can have both a client VPN connection to our network and Internet access on their own local network?
